Output 109e1017e4c679b4cfc788c25681d0914dbe2060ed1aa191dc5f09a475972bdf:59

value
1263248
script pubkey
OP_0 OP_PUSHBYTES_20 5326c0d3c75fce554d5a2dfbbe6331358b14d8d2
address
bc1q2vnvp578tl892n269hamuce3xk93fkxjtz72xn
transaction
109e1017e4c679b4cfc788c25681d0914dbe2060ed1aa191dc5f09a475972bdf
spent
true